About 1st Grade Common Core Engineering Design Resources

On Education.com, parents and teachers can explore a variety of engineering design resources designed for first-grade students. These include printable worksheets, hands-on activity guides, and lesson plans that introduce young learners to engineering principles such as asking questions, sketching modifications, testing solutions, and understanding structural parts. These activities align with the 1st Grade Common Core Math Standards, encouraging problem-solving and critical thinking skills. Educators can access structured materials that foster collaboration, creativity, and innovation in early-childhood science education.

First-grade students can engage with exercises that involve building with blocks, constructing paper parachutes (egg drops), or designing shelters. Education.com provides step-by-step guides and interactive printable templates that make engineering concepts accessible and fun. These resources help children understand the part each component plays in a structure and introduce foundational engineering practices through playful experimentation.
